**Community Manager** - Scarborough
At Park Property, our residents deserve a comfortable environment in which they can realize their dreams. To ensure we consistently deliver this to residents, we are looking for a Community Manager to join our team.
Reporting to the Property Manager, the Community Manager is responsible for ensuring our residents feel good about where they live. If you take pride in being a champion for resident relations and provide best-in-class customer service, this role located within our Carabob Court community is perfect for you
**_
What you will do:_**
- Promote a strong sense of community by maintaining an overall focus on enhancing the customer experience
- Respond to all inquiries, feedback, complaints or concerns from residents (current and perspective) professionally and courteously and follow up as required
- Accountable for day to day activities as it relates to resident services, service providers, and contractors
- Ensure effective communication with residents, consistent with their expectations
- Maintain good resident relations, handling & documenting resident complaints & any emergencies in the building which occur during, over & above office hours
- Partner with Marketing & Leasing on overall Resident experience strategies at the property
- Provide input for planning and budgeting, inclusive of annual budget preparation, reforecasts, management plans, performance reports, and variance reports
- Work with colleagues to coordinate month-end duties and responsibilities, including suite pre-inspection, and scheduling of contractors and staff for turnover of suites
- Perform regular and proactive inspections of the property and make recommendations as required
- Conduct regular market surveys, analyzing competition & identifying market trends for the purpose of providing input & recommendations on pricing & strategy
- Educate residents, when appropriate, on the rules & regulations of the property
- Complete weekly/monthly reports as required
- Organize resident events/activities aligned to the resident base to increase customer loyalty
- Supports team goals, objectives, operations & strategy for properties outlined by management
- Support the Property Manager with other related duties as required when required
**_ Who you are:_**
- Possess exceptional communication and interpersonal relationship skills
- 3 + years of management experience with multiple reports
- College education in a business or related field, university degree considered an asset
- Completion of (or working towards) Property Management Designation considered to be an asset
- High degree of diplomacy, integrity, discretion and confidentiality
- Leadership abilities that inspire others
- High degree of integrity, initiative, agility, creativity and flexibility
- Ability to work with a diverse group of people and interests while being culturally aware
- Intermediate knowledge of MS Office (Word, Excel, and PowerPoint)
